Job Summary

Senior Environmental Specialist - Air responsible for serving as SME on Clean Air Act regulations and air permitting; coordinating permitting activities for Refining and Renewable Fuels projects; providing environmental engineering support to ensure compliance with environmental programs; building relationships with refinery and operations teams; leading auditing and compliance initiatives; supporting regulatory advocacy and budgeting discussions; travel and on-site work at multiple MPC refineries/headquarters with after-hours and field duties; relocation may be available.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in a HES related field or Engineering degree
  • 7 years relevant professional environmental experience in a process industry such as refining, midstream, petrochemical or other heavy industry
  • Detailed knowledge on current and proposed environmental Air Rules and Regulations (Air quality regulations, including NSPS, MACT, NESHAP, Emissions Inventory, NSR, PSD, and Title V)
  • Must be proficient in Microsoft Word, Excel and Outlook
  • Must be able to wear appropriate PPE in the refinery (respirator) and physically perform all tasks in the field
  • Must have a valid driver’s license
  • Must be legally authorized to work in the US without the need for future VISA sponsorship
  • Travel requirement 25%-50%
  • Must be able to obtain a TWIC Card
